Document capture is becoming increasingly expensive, and sensitive documents cannot be sent to the cloud. This is often the case for government agencies, hospitals, or banks.
We have designed an AI solution that addresses these challenges: OCR, classification, and extraction are handled by open-source LLM models, run entirely on your infrastructure. No documents leave your network. This is sovereign AI in the strictest sense: the model comes to the data.
It is currently running in production for our clients and processes several thousand documents per day without manual intervention.
The source code is transferred to clients: they manage the solution in-house, without dependence on a vendor and without licenses to renew. We remain involved in operations and maintenance, depending on their Team's needs. The result is an ROI that increases as volume grows.
In this session, Mathieu Caudron demonstrates the product in action: the architecture, the document pipeline, the role of human validation, and how we balance local, hybrid, and cloud execution based on project constraints.
